From: David Chappell <David.Chappell@mail.cc.trincoll.edu> Date: 18 Apr 2002 20:45:21 -0400 Subject: Re: PPR: ppr 1.44 not collating jobs from Windows2000 On Mon, 2002-04-01 at 09:01, Brian Parise wrote: > When printing multiple copies with the collating option box checked, it > print outs the multiple copies, but not collated. In the ps file there is a > NumCopies comment set to the number of copies requested, and there is a > <<Collate true>> comment as well. It prints collated, when printing straight > to the printer from windows, but I would really like to continue to use ppr > as a spooler. Any thoughts?? Yes. First make sure you are using the same PPD file on Windows and PPR. Generally this isn't important, but sometimes a vendor will use a non-standard name for an option and this can cause problems.
